Compact free zoo set within Golders Hill Park featuring lemurs, deer, donkeys, and owls alongside a large playground, walled gardens, nature trails, and picnic areas with ample shade.
Lovely park. With a small zoo ,walled gardens very impressive pergola a nice cafe with a varied menu various ponds quite hilly with open parkland and woodland. limited parking but only a ten minute walk from golders green station

Overview
Golders Hill Park Zoo offers free access to lemurs, deer, donkeys, and owls within a scenic North London park. Facilities include a large playground, walled gardens, cafe, tennis and ping pong courts, and shaded picnic spots. The zoo enclosures are double-fenced, which limits close viewing and keeps the setting calm and family-friendly. The terrain is hilly with open parkland and woodland trails.
